Output 2d757a886184ee80e427c84979685dc56cf6be317cf3766e1b7a6e67b14c16ad:1

value
101000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b81dd12fcf6aaf88f6c55671c0e132e4339c2448 OP_EQUAL
address
3JUXya6fGGNHjUSBGrH7QTwwzgE1MaNTJn
transaction
2d757a886184ee80e427c84979685dc56cf6be317cf3766e1b7a6e67b14c16ad
spent
true